Kashyap Kompella is the Founder and CEO of rpa2ai, a global industry analyst firm focusing on automation and artificial intelligence. Kashyap has 20 years of experience as a hands-on technologist, industry analyst, and management consultant.

Kashyap advises large organizations on technology strategy, implementation road maps, and vendor selection. Prior to rpa2ai, Kashyap was a Research Director at Real Story Group, Senior Advisor at Information Services Group, and Practice Head at Wipro. Kashyap is widely recognized as a thought leader on emerging technologies and has been quoted by the media, including the BBC, Quartz, the Economist, Mint, Guardian, Forbes, Nikkei Asian Review, eMarketer, CMSWire, KMWorld, EContent, and SearchCIO.
